What Does “Statement of Work” Mean?
A Statement of Work (SOW) is a formal document that outlines the specific tasks, deliverables, timelines, and expectations of a project. It defines what work needs to be done, how it will be done, and the standards by which it will be measured.

What Does “Unique Selling Proposition” Mean?
A Unique Selling Proposition is the factor that differentiates your product, service, or brand from all others in the marketplace. It’s the answer to the question every customer asks: “Why should I choose you over the competition?”
A USP can be based on:
Features (what your product does differently),
Benefits (what outcomes your customers get), or
Values (what your brand stands for).

Why Execution Matters in Business
Ideas are plentiful. Execution is rare. In the world of business:
Strategy without execution is hallucination. A brilliant plan has no value if it’s never acted upon.
Execution builds trust. Clients, teams, and stakeholders remember not what you intended, but what you delivered.
Execution drives momentum. Each successful action creates confidence and fuels future growth.
